Default NYC-ANNOUNCE Interop City

New York Area user groups are joining forces for Interop City, an
interoperability event, with the help of the International ***ociation
of Software Architects (IASA)! Join us for this special event sponsored
by BEA, Microsoft, Compuware and JNBridge on July 14th, where you'll
hear some of the best speakers on the subject of software
interoperability between .NET and several J2EE platforms, in addition
to some discussions on best practice approaches to interop, Web
services, and more.

Some of the user groups participating are:
- New York City Rational User Group
- BEA dev2dev
- New York City chapter of the IASA
- New Jersey Enterprise Visual Basic User Group
- NYPC Visual Basic SIG
- Virtual Websphere z/OS User Group
- New Jersey Developers Group
- Long Island LINUX User Group
- New York City .NET Developers Group
- New York Software Industry ***ociation .NET SIG
- Northern New Jersey .NET User Group

This is a first-of-its-kind collective effort between the user groups
in the New York Area, where you'll have a chance to network with like
minds in other platforms and disciplines. This is a catered event that
will provide you with a full day of presentations, demonstrations and
dialog from a fantastic line-up of interoperability experts.
